Will AI replace front end developers 2023 09 19T131813.946
Will AI replace front end developers 2023 09 19T131813.946

A Comprehensive Guide to Web Development: Process, Perks, and Company Structure

Introduction

In this comprehensive guide, we will delve into the world of e will also dissect the web development, exploring its significance in modern industries. Wven crucial stages of the web development cycle and gain insights into the typical organizational structure of web development companies. If you’re eager to learn more about front-end developers or discover the best front-end languages, check out our blog for further information.

Understanding Web Development

Web development constitutes the intricate process of crafting websites and web applications. A typical web development company operates as a seasoned establishment, offering a suite of professional services, including UX/UI design, development, and the implementation of websites, web applications, web portals, and other web-based solutions.

What Web Development Companies Offer

Web development companies are experts in the realm of website creation, specializing in mobile-first, responsive, accessible, and dynamic web solutions tailored to diverse business types (B2B or B2C), industry-specific requirements, target audiences, budgets, and maintenance needs.

Exploring Web Development Company Structures

A professional web development company can adopt either a linear or non-linear organizational structure. Typically, it incorporates a blend of both approaches. Key team members include project managers, UX/UI designers, web developers (front-end, back-end, and full-stack), quality assurance engineers, and marketing professionals such as managers, writers, and SEO specialists.

The Seven Stages of Web Development

The web development cycle encompasses all the phases a web product undergoes during its development journey, from conceptualization to a fully operational solution. Here are the seven distinct stages of this cycle:

1. Analysis The development process commences with rigorous research and analysis. Teams gather insights from stakeholders, delve into market trends, industry best practices, and conduct competitor analyses. All findings are meticulously documented.

2. Planning Planning involves mapping out deliverables and crafting a comprehensive roadmap for the future website or application, considering potential risks and room for adjustments. This stage also encompasses the product discovery process.

3. Design During the design phase, teams focus on creating and testing the user interface layout. Initial concepts evolve into detailed wireframes and prototypes, incorporating visual elements such as buttons, interactions, menus, colors, fonts, and graphics.

4. Development The development stage unfolds once a fully-fledged prototype is in place. It involves translating designs into functional web pages using code. The front-end development caters to the client side, while the back-end manages the logic, databases, and servers.

5. Testing Thorough testing and quality assurance ensure the flawless performance of the web solution. Web developers assess response times, capacity limits, load endurance, and various system behaviors to eliminate any bugs or glitches.

6. Implementation After gaining approval from previous stages, implementation or deployment takes place. The web app or website is hosted on servers using the standard communication protocol, FTP (File Transfer Protocol).

7. Maintenance Maintenance remains a critical step, as web solutions are not static. Regular updates are essential to adapt to evolving business needs, technological advancements, and user feedback, ensuring the continued success of the product.

Why Hire a Web Development Company

To summarize, web development companies, whether local or remote, excel in guiding businesses through the entire development process. They offer assistance in:

  1. Ideation and layout planning for websites and apps.
  2. Designing exceptional user interfaces and experiences.
  3. Front-end and back-end programming.
  4. Seamless integration of client-side and server-side components.
  5. Content and media element integration, including product descriptions, UX copy, video, audio, and images.
  6. Rigorous bug fixing and performance testing.
  7. Ongoing maintenance and updates to keep the web product current and competitive.
Conclusion

In today’s digital landscape, having a well-crafted web solution is not just an option but a necessity for establishing a credible business presence. Customers seek convenience online, making the internet the first point of contact. Understanding web development, its processes, and the role of web development companies is paramount in meeting the demands of the modern market.

© 2013 - 2024 Foreignerds. All Rights Reserved

facebookFacebook
twitterTwitter
linkedinLinkedin
instagramInstagram
whatsapp
support